Magnus Norddahl
|
ac518e23bf
|
- improve triangle setup performance a little bit
|
2017-03-24 20:00:53 +01:00 |
|
Magnus Norddahl
|
bc8a4474d5
|
- optimize PolyTriangleDrawer::clipedge
- remove slow calls to roundf in the triangle setup functions
|
2017-03-24 13:04:02 +01:00 |
|
Magnus Norddahl
|
11e5759913
|
- detached the poly renderer from the software renderer
|
2017-03-20 08:28:16 +01:00 |
|
Magnus Norddahl
|
3838ec3edc
|
- allow drawer queues to run immediately to improve r_scene_multithreaded performance
- removed unused pass ranges in DrawerThread
|
2017-03-14 23:03:14 +01:00 |
|
Magnus Norddahl
|
ad507ca246
|
Removed drawergen tool and all LLVM dependencies (don't let the door hit you on your way out, llvm!)
|
2017-02-23 08:28:18 +01:00 |
|
Magnus Norddahl
|
c918950ff6
|
Add php drawer for the poly renderer
|
2017-02-21 09:08:51 +01:00 |
|
Magnus Norddahl
|
6f5e720576
|
Split drawer command queue from drawer threads
|
2017-02-04 12:38:05 +01:00 |
|
Magnus Norddahl
|
80e1844d6c
|
Split r_main into r_viewport, r_scene and r_light
|
2017-01-12 16:21:46 +01:00 |
|
Magnus Norddahl
|
d3056d2679
|
Split poly_triangle into multiple files
|
2016-12-30 02:20:24 +01:00 |
|
Magnus Norddahl
|
2659090e1c
|
Move renders into folders
|
2016-12-27 06:31:55 +01:00 |
|